Very disappointed in this shop. After attending a seminar hosted at the shop with another Piper Comanche owner and being impressed by their knowledge, I commissioned this shop to perform a pre-purchase inspection for me on a 65’ PA24 260. This was my first airplane purchase and I was buying an airplane I had not yet seen in person. I relayed this information over the phone and advised that I was entrusting them to be both my eyes and ears and required them to guide me as I was inexperienced in airplane purchases. I asked for their opinion on a very extensive prebuy and was told that most extensive would be a full annual inspection. Aside from that, the next step down was a $1500 inspection which included removing all inspection panels/cowl, swinging the gear, borescope and engine inspection, functional check of all systems, review of logs, an AD compliance check, etc. The plane had just come out of an extensive annual by another shop the previous month and after talking with the shop owner and at his advice I opted to go with the second option. I will say they were very friendly and accommodating and provided a very comfortable feeling. I truly trusted them. I arranged for the plane to be ferried to them and dropped off for their inspection. The plane was left for nearly a week to complete the inspection. I then had a friend and a ferry pilot fly with me to pick up the plane. Upon arrival the plane had been moved to the ramp and was supposedly ready for us to fly home. This is where the red flags should have started waiving. Upon completing a visual inspection of the aircraft we found that 3 spark plug wires were left disconnected and a valve cover fastener had been left missing during their inspection. The shop owner was standing there when these items were found and he was apologetic and clearly not happy with his mechanic. They fixed those issues and we flew the plane home. Within the first 10 hrs of my ownership numerous deficiencies were uncovered that very clearly should have been caught during the pre-purchase inspection. I’m now a year and a half into my ownership and have only been able to fly the airplane for 32hrs as it’s been down for repairs for the majority of my ownership and cost almost $30k for repairs. When I spoke to the mechanic who performed the inspection she stated this is one of the better airplanes shes inspected and was basically told that it was in great condition. I found out that she had only been there a week and clearly had no oversight while inspecting my plane. Essentially had these items been found I likely wouldn’t have purchased this airplane and I certainly wouldn’t have paid what I did for it. This shop’s oversight has cost me dearly and I’m nearly to the point of giving up on aviation all together. Extremely discouraged, but now I’m past the point of no return on the plane financially … hopefully this will save someone else from having the same experience.
